How they compare
Croatia currently reports 33 Cases against 30 Cases in Myanmar, a difference of 3 Cases.
That makes Croatia's figure about 1.1 times Myanmar's.
The two have swapped places 3 times across 34 shared years of data; in 1990 it was Myanmar ahead.
Croatia ranks 99th and Myanmar ranks 101st of 210 countries.
Myanmar has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Croatia | Myanmar |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 235.6 Cases | 2,481 Cases | 2,246 Cases | Myanmar |
| 2000s | 15.2 Cases | 908.3 Cases | 893.1 Cases | Myanmar |
| 2010s | 34.78 Cases | 1,514 Cases | 1,479 Cases | Myanmar |
| 2020s | 7.2 Cases | 101.4 Cases | 94.2 Cases | Myanmar |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
